Output 17f05aa07898943fd9087bf5622ba86e144e15e236c24bc15cc18b0151a7ad89:0

value
27407611
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e1d25c9a86c43c8adbd064d73e7d3a8fbb8b6b5 OP_EQUALVERIFY OP_CHECKSIG
address
LYBP8fUqB1ShqEdXzdMS4Q9fyDUgffaG44
transaction
17f05aa07898943fd9087bf5622ba86e144e15e236c24bc15cc18b0151a7ad89
spent
true